The Tigre Reserve of Rajaji National Park densely populated by the Sal Forest and some other forest types which combine the Western Gangetic Moist and Northern dry Deciduous and Khair-Sissoo forests. Low-Alluvial Woodlands cover the southern margins of the park, on the other hand, the Shivalik The Himalayas covers Chir-Pine trees. The Tigre Reserve Eco-Tour brings you plenty of wildlife and nature here. It is the most breathtaking wilderness & Eco-Friendly Tigre Reserve Eco-Tour near Rishikesh & Haridwar.
The Tigre Reserve protects such as the Royal Bengal Tiger and Leopard. The lesser-carnivores like the Jackal, Hyena, Jungle Cat, Leopard Cat, Civets, Himalayan Yellow-Throated Marten Himalayan Black and Sloth Bears. Today, there are 30 tigers and around 285 leopards. The primates including the Rhesus Macaque and the Hanuman Languor. The Indian Hare and the Indian Porcupine is one of the small mammals that you see in the Reserve.
The Himalayan birds, such as Oriental Pied Hornbill, Crested Kingfisher and Crimson Sunbird are permanently living in the Reserve. And, most of the birds migrate during winter seasons. The plenty of nature's reward piled-up in and around the reserve.
